What is Utah Physical Therapy?
Utah Physical Therapy operates as a specialized provider of musculoskeletal and rehabilitative care, offering targeted interventions for conditions ranging from chronic lower back pain to complex shoulder and knee injuries. The company distinguishes itself through a patient-centric model that integrates pediatric physical therapy with adult orthopedic recovery, all delivered by certified local practitioners. By maintaining a network of clinics that prioritize a clean, safe, and accessible environment, the firm has successfully captured a significant share of the regional outpatient rehabilitation market. Their commitment to accepting diverse insurance plans further cements their role as a critical healthcare provider for a broad demographic of patients seeking to regain mobility and return to active lifestyles.
